zoukankan      html  css  js  c++  java
  • 【场景切换的多种调用方式】

    LoadLevel
    Loads the level by its name or index.
    加载场景,加载之前你需要把场景在Build Settings添加,场景加载后,场景中的激活物体会调用MonoBehavior:OnLevelWasLoaded().使用该方法的时候,之前场景中的物体将会被直接删除。

    LoadLevelAdditive
    Loads a level additively.
    该方法不销毁当前场景中的物体,新场景中的物体将会被添加进来,这个方法在一些连续加载的场景中非常有用哈。

    LoadLevelAdditiveAsync
    Loads the level additively and asynchronously in the background.
    在后台异步记载场景
    unity会在后台线程中加载所有的场景资源,这就允许你在加载新场景过程中播放一个进度条或者通过异步加载
    该方法会返回 AsyncOperation结构,结构中 isDone表示是否完成,
    progress给出当前的播放进度。注意的是在编辑器中后台线程的性能要低于游戏中。

    LoadLevelAsync
    Loads the level asynchronously in the background.
    在后台异步记载场景,unity会在后台线程中加载所有的场景资源,这就允许你在加载新场景过程中播放一个进度条或者通过异步加载
    该方法会返回 AsyncOperation结构,结构中 isDone表示是否完成,
    progress给出当前的播放进度。注意的是在编辑器中后台线程的性能要低于游戏中。

  • 相关阅读:
    dedecms初解
    Java二十三设计模式之------单例模式
    Java二十三设计模式之------工厂方法模式
    数组和集合的区别及深入了解
    团队项目计划
    团队介绍及团队题目
    第二阶段冲刺(第十天)
    第二阶段冲刺(第九天)
    第二阶段冲刺(第八天)
    第二阶段冲刺(第七天)
  • 原文地址:https://www.cnblogs.com/yexiaopeng/p/6273696.html
Copyright © 2011-2022 走看看